面向高级支付与智能经济的TP钱包下载速度优化深度分析

引言

在移动金融应用场景中,TP钱包的下载与更新速度直接影响用户首因体验、活跃度与支付转化率。本文从技术实现、支付系统对接、智能化经济转型视角出发,系统性剖析下载速度瓶颈并给出可落地的优化策略,同时强调公钥管理与数据防护在安全与合规场景中的重要性。

一、瓶颈识别(行业观察分析)

1. 分发层:单中心化服务器、区域镜像缺失、CDN策略不优导致首包时延高与丢包率上升。2. 包体层:APK/AAB体积大、资源冗余(图片、内置SDK)与单次全量更新频繁。3. 协议层:使用传统HTTP/1.1或未启用并优化TLS 1.3、没有开启QUIC/HTTP3导致握手与多路复用劣势。4. 终端层:网络波动下断点续传、差异更新支持不足、校验/解压流程阻塞UI线程。5. 合规与安全:更新包签名验证、公钥分发不够高效或有中心化风险,影响自动更新链路可信度。

二、下载优化的技术策略

1. 分发与网络层

- 全面部署多区域CDN并结合S3/对象存储多活镜像,按用户地理归属智能调度。- 启用HTTP/2或HTTP/3(QUIC),减少握手与包头开销,提升并发流性能。- 使用TCP/UDP传输参数优化(如拥塞控制、MTU调整),在移动网络下降低丢包重传。- 边缘计算:在边缘节点做轻量化解压与差异计算,缩短回传与安装时间。

2. 包体与更新策略

- 应用拆分与模块化:将核心支付SDK和非关键模块分离,首安装包保持最小化(核心钱包+基础支付),延后加载可选功能。- 增量与差分更新:采用二进制差分(bsdiff/xdelta)或基于文件级别的delta,配合内容寻址(hash manifest)减少下载流量。- A/B包与热补丁:小变更优先使用热修复或JavaScript层补丁,避免全量降级。- 支持断点续传与多线程下载,利用分片并行加速大文件下载。

3. P2P与混合分发模型

- 在合规允许的范围内,针对大规模更新采用受控P2P(基于WebRTC或自研P2P)辅助分发,减轻中心流量峰值。- 引入信誉与安全策略,确保接收端校验签名并限制可信节点集合。

4. 客户端体验优化

- 采用安装预热与智能预取:基于用户行为预测模型在低流量时段预下载差异包或可选模块。- 非阻塞安装流程与异步解压,确保UI快速响应并展示渐进式功能。

三、安全设计:公钥与数据防护

1. 更新与签名验证

- 使用非对称签名(推荐Ed25519或ECDSA)对安装包与差异包进行签名,客户端仅接受通过签名验证的包。- 公钥采用多渠道分发策略:应用内嵌初始公钥+远程可信配置更新(HTTPS+证书固定/公钥打桩),并支持公钥轮换机制与回滚验证。- 增加签名链或时间戳服务,防止重放与中间人攻击。2. 密钥管理与终端保护

- 服务端私钥托管在HSM或云KMS中,严格访问控制与审计。- 客户端敏感操作使用平台Keystore/KeyChain(TEE/SE)生成和存储私钥短期凭证,避免明文私钥暴露。3. 数据传输与静态数据保护

- 全程TLS 1.3+前向保密,必要时使用双向TLS或轻量级证书绑定以提升链路可信度。- 安装包内敏感配置或凭证采用静态加密,运行时在受保护内存/容器中解密。4. 完整性校验与远程证明

- 在下载完成后做分块哈希校验(Merkle树)以加速大包校验并支持部分重试。- 结合远程证明(如Android SafetyNet、iOS DeviceCheck或TEE远程证明)验证终端环境的完整性,防止被篡改的客户端参与分发体系。

四、高级支付系统与智能化经济转型的耦合影响

- 支付系统对可用性与低延迟高度敏感,下载/更新体验作为接入门槛直接影响商户与终端用户接纳。- 模块化钱包允许按需接入不同支付清算模块(区块链网关、银行卡通道、数字人民币SDK等),减少初始包体积,加速商用部署。- 智能化转型推动边缘结算、微支付与离线同步,要求客户端能快速安装/更新以适配新的支付规则与合规要求。

五、信息化创新趋势与前瞻

- 5G+边缘计算使得小文件的低延迟分发成为常态,边缘智能可在用户侧预测性下发更新。- QUIC/HTTP3与多路径传输(MPTCP)将显著减少移动网络抖动带来的影响。- AI驱动的差分预测、用户行为模型与资源裁剪将进一步压缩首包体积与提高命中率。

六、指标、测试与落地路线

- 推荐KPI:首次可交互时间(FTI)、首字节时间(TTFB)、下载成功率、平均恢复时间(断点续传成功率)、更新导致的日活留存变化。- 测试覆盖:多运营商、不同地理区域、弱网场景、AppStore与第三方市场下载差异。- 落地步骤:1) 包体瘦身与模块化;2) 部署CDN+边缘加速;3) 启用差分更新与签名校验;4) 安全加固(KMS/HSM、公钥轮换);5) 引入预测预取与P2P试点;6) 量化监控与持续优化。

结语

将下载速度优化作为产品与安全的协同工程,不仅能提升用户体验和支付转化,还能为TP钱包在智能经济转型中提供更快的产品迭代能力和更高的安全信任基线。通过分发架构优化、包体与协议升级、严格的公钥与密钥管理,以及面向业务的模块化设计,可在保证数据防护与合规的前提下,实现可量化的下载性能跃迁。

作者:林澈发布时间:2025-09-19 21:38:34

评论

Skyler

很实用的技术路线,特别是把公钥轮换和边缘部署结合得很好。

小雨

能否展开说说在国内各大应用市场(如华为、小米)部署差分更新的注意事项?

MaxChen

建议补充关于iOS App Store与Android各厂商商店签名策略的差异对更新速度的影响。

阿蓝

P2P分发的合规风险点讲得清晰,期待看到实测数据和成本评估。

相关阅读